PKP LHS
- This is an article about Polish railway company. For an article about railway line the company services go to: Linia Hutnicza Szerokotorowa
PKP LHS is a company of the PKP Group responsible for infrastructure operation and freight transport on the Broad Gauge Metallurgy Line. The line runs for about 400 km from the Polish-Ukrainian border in Izow-Hrubieszów to Sławków Południowy (near Katowice).
In 2004 the LHS line run on average 6.4 trains daily, transporting about 7,300,000 t. of cargo. The motive stock of the company consist of 50 PKP class ST44 diesel locomotives and 8 PKP class SM48 diesel locomotives.
The company was founded in 2001 after splitting Polskie Koleje Państwowe (the national rail operator) into several smaller companies.
